Yates bounces back in tie-down; Brown, Long stretch lead in team roping

(December 5, 2016) — Marty Yates bounced back in grand style Sunday night, running the fastest time of the opening four rounds to win the tie-down roping at the National Finals Rodeo in Las Vegas.

Yates roped and tied his calf in 6.8 seconds in Round 4 at Thomas & Mack Center, bouncing back after no times in the second and third rounds took him out of the average. Yates was also second in 7.2 seconds in Round 1, and has won almost $47,000 at the NFR, moving him to fifth in the current world standings with more than $120,000 for the year.

Stephenville header Luke Brown and Morgan Mill heeler Jake Long continued their steady run at the NFR and their prolific 2016 season, placing third Sunday in 4.9 seconds for more than $15,000 each. They pushed their total at the NFR to more than $64,000 after making the money in each of the opening four rounds. Each now has more than $175,000 for the year and leads of more than $22,000.

Brown and Long are in a particularly good position in the average, where they are one of only four teams to successfully rope four head and enter Round 5 Monday holding an advantage of nine seconds over second place.

Jacobs Crawley has seen his lead in the saddle bronc riding standings slip to just more than $1,000 and is currently out of the average after a no score on Sunday.
